Output 91d8b8c25adb8ba950624342b54538eca94bf650a6e89d996828a8670ee1e256:2

value
128408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b90f00e99ba21c3e46b5d90e26dc98486ea6fb0 OP_EQUAL
address
3CxNfb5hjq9cQMgSGytK5eukqiAHZkwG6V
transaction
91d8b8c25adb8ba950624342b54538eca94bf650a6e89d996828a8670ee1e256
spent
true